Job Summary
Dominion Energy is actively seeking a candidate to support the sales and development of residential customer offerings as part of our new and innovative business segment, Dominion Energy Solutions. Current offerings include rooftop solar, battery storage, and EV charging for homes.
There is one position available for this requisition and it will be filled at the level commensurate with successful candidate's knowledge, skills, and experience.
Additional responsibilities include:
-
Leveraging superb customer service skills and technical acumen providing a white-glove experience for customers, supporting the processes that drive their project from lead gen through operations.
-
Intakes new customers, evaluates project viability, designs projects, and advises customers on energy solutions.
-
Serves as a customer-first energy advisor, bringing a high level of integrity and transparency to the sales process.
-
Attends site visits as needed throughout the specified market and is an ambassador for the Dominion Energy brand exhibiting Dominion’s core values in all areas of responsibility.
-
Perform other job-related duties as assigned.
